#334271 Color
#334271 is rgb(51, 66, 113) in RGB, hsl(225, 38%, 32%) in HSL, and about cmyk(55%, 42%, 0%, 56%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Purple Navy (#4E5180), clearly related but distinguishable side by side at ΔE 8.23. White text is the more readable choice on this background.

#334271 Channel Values
How #334271 bre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 51 · G 66 · B 113 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 225° · S 38% · L 32%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 225° · S 55% · V 44%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 55% · M 42% · Y 0% · K 56%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 9.73:1 vs white · 2.16: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|

#334271 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#334271?
#334271 is a dark blue — rgb(51, 66, 113) in RGB and hsl(225, 38%, 32%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Purple Navy (#4E5180), which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side at a CIE76 distance of 8.23.
What is the RGB value of #334271?
#334271 is rgb(51, 66, 113) — red 51, green 66, and blue 113 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#334271?
#334271 converts to approximately cmyk(55%, 42%, 0%, 56%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#334271 be black or white?
White text is the more readable choice. #334271 scores 9.73:1 against white and 2.16: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#334271 as a CSS color keyword?
No. #334271 is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is darkslateblue (#483D8B) at a CIE76 distance of 20.93, which is visibly different.
